Buzz Lightyear's famous Toy Story catchphrase, used in edits, memes and nostalgic clips when a scene needs a dramatic heroic launch.

This sound is the classic Buzz Lightyear line, "To infinity and beyond," delivered with big heroic confidence. It is short, punchy and instantly recognizable, with a bold animated movie tone that feels adventurous and slightly over-the-top in the best way. The clip works well when you want a moment to feel like a grand mission, a ridiculous leap of faith or a childhood throwback. Because the phrase is so well known, it can make even a small action feel larger, funnier and more triumphant the second it plays.

"To infinity and beyond" is Buzz Lightyear's signature catchphrase from Disney and Pixar's Toy Story, first released in 1995. The line became one of the most quoted parts of the film and spread widely through GIFs, remixes and short meme edits. It still shows up in nostalgic posts, parody trailers and reaction videos because it instantly signals bold ambition, childish optimism and a slightly exaggerated sense of heroism. Online, creators often use it for takeoff gags, big reveals or a triumphant setup that may end in a fail.

Sık Sorulan Sorular

What is the To Infinity and Beyond sound?
It is the famous Buzz Lightyear catchphrase "To infinity and beyond" used as a short reaction and meme sound. Creators add it to launches, bold decisions and playful heroic moments that need a nostalgic movie reference.
Where is the To Infinity and Beyond quote from?
The quote comes from Toy Story, the 1995 animated film from Disney and Pixar. It is closely associated with Buzz Lightyear and became one of the most recognizable lines from the movie series.
Why do people use this sound in memes?
People use it because the line instantly communicates confidence, adventure and exaggerated heroism. It works especially well when someone is about to jump, run, commit to a risky plan or treat a tiny action like an epic mission.
